Public bug reported: Look where the red arrow is pointing in this screenshot: http://neartalk.com/ss/Totem.png
This orange on orange it too subtle to indicate the video is 21 seconds along. I notices that this occurs on the Apple Movie Trailers inclued with Totem. Videos I play from the local file system are orange and white (clearly indicating progress).
